  • Patent number: 5947458
    Abstract: An apparatus for an active suspension system provides independent control of each adjustable spring rate mechanism. Ride height, spring rate, and oscillation control are achieved with the use of transducers that send signals to a controller. The controller receives the signals and responsively generates signals to adjust pressure and flow between an accumulator and the adjustable spring rate mechanism.

  • Patent number: 5848639
    Abstract: A heat exchanger includes a first header and tank assembly having an inlet port and an outlet port. First and second tubes are included, each tube in fluid communication with the first header and tank assembly and with the other tube. An elastomeric baffle is disposed in the first header and tank assembly to substantially prevent fluid flow between the inlet port and the outlet port except through the first and second tubes.
